RE: teton and yellowstone

I've stayed at Grant Village in Yellowstone. No hookups but sites are better and allow campfires. Fishing Bridge has hookups, sites are very tight and no campfires.
It's a NO-NO on unleashed fogs. Sorry. And they could end up as a meal for a coyote. I'm not kidding. Don't even leave them tied up outside unattended.
Flagg Ranch, I heard good and some bad. It's right outside Yellowstone's south entrance and but I personally think Colter Bay would be a better choice. One area has hookups and might be full but the other campground is pretty big, without hookups. Make sure you get a loop that allows generators.

RE: Boondocking in small Class A?

Our Class A is 38' and ground clearance is about the only thing that limits me.
With a 100 gallon fresh water tank we can stay longer than most without moving.
I don't however see many other coachs where I go. Mostly TT's and 5ers.
We have the generator, inverter and other amenities, why not use them.
